Born Katie Kallen, her father was a barber, her mother died prior to Katie's tenth birthday. Her passion for singing began during her early youth and she acquired performance experience on the radio program The Children's Hour, which was sponsored by the Philadelphia-area restaurant Horn and Hardart's. She was one of the top vocalists during the big band era and sang with the Benny Goodman and Tommy Dorsey orchestras. Her biggest top ten hit in the 1950’s was “Little Things Mean A Lot”.
